Driving a high voltage, low impedance “I2C” bus Power dissipation under fault conditions The current drive capability of the buffered Tx and Ty outputs exceeds 100 mA. If a wiring fault causes a short from these pins to VCC (or to a buffered bus supply when using different supplies) then high dissipations result when Sx or Sy are driven low. The rated 300 mW dissipation can be exceeded within a very short time. Appropriate precautions should be taken to ensure that such a short-circuit does not occur. Bus characteristics and rise/fall times In general terms, the rise times which will be observed on a bus driven by the P82B96 will be simply determined by the pull-up resistor used and the total capacitive load presented to the bus. The fall time is determined mostly by the dynamic pull down current capability and the capacitive load, with some modification caused by the varying current in the bus pull up resistor. The effective logic signal propagation time will depend on the input logic thresholds of the P82B96, and of any other devices connected to the I2C or buffered bus. On a 2 V supply, the Sx and Sy thresholds are approaching half the supply rail. On a 5V supply their (0.65V) threshold is much closer to GND than usual for logic inputs. This causes some additional delay in the effective propagation time on falling edges, and reduces those delays on the rising edges. For Rx and Ry, the threshold is always 50% of VCC so switching levels are ‘conventional’ when the buffered bus pull-ups are connected to VCC. However, if the buffered bus pull-ups connect to a supply voltage different to VCC, the rise/fall times required to reach the Rx threshold may need to be taken into account. P82B96 response time for propagation of low to high at Sx With Tx connected to Rx, a low at Sx causes a low at Tx and thus to Rx. The low at Rx enables a ‘clamp’ at 1V, the logic low, on Sx. So when the Sx input is released, the voltage on the I2C bus rises towards this 1V clamping level set by the return signal from Rx, which is still low. As Sx rises past its 0.65V input threshold, the Tx output drive will be released. The Tx output voltage will begin to rise at a rate determined by its load capacitance and the pull up resistor used at Tx. With Tx connected to Rx, when it reaches 50% of the VCC supply voltage the Rx input senses that Tx has been released, and returns a ‘high’ signal to its output at Sx, allowing this voltage to continue its rise again towards the I2C supply. It will be recognized as high by other I2C chips when it reaches their logic threshold. Typical waveforms are shown in Figure 8. This delay in termination of the low signal on Sx will be further extended if Tx and Rx are not directly linked and there are other delays inherent in the signal path between Tx and Rx.
